Canada - Import of Copper Sulphates
Since 2014, Canada Import of Copper Sulphates was down by 4.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 4 among other countries in Import of Copper Sulphates at $32,614,058. Canada is overtaken by Indonesia, which was number 3 with $32,970,439.18 and is followed by Germany with $18,217,171. United States lead the ranking with $101,669,330.27 in 2019, an increase of 5.6% compared to 2018. Guyana recorded the best 5 years average growth at +498.9% per year, while Andorra recorded the worst performance at -49.9% per year.
